The name Jerry, often perceived as a friendly and approachable name, has roots as a diminutive of the name Gerald or Gerard. Gerald, of German origin, translates to "spear ruler," combining the elements "ger" (spear) and "wald" (rule). Gerard, also of German origin, carries a similar meaning, signifying "brave spear" or "strong spear." Therefore, Jerry, in its essence, inherits a sense of strength, leadership, and bravery, albeit in a more casual and accessible form.
Jerry Name Popularity
How popular is the name Jerry? Here’s everything we know.
Analyzing the historical popularity of the name Jerry reveals a fascinating trend. The name experienced a surge in popularity throughout the first half of the 20th century. Examining data from the Social Security Administration (SSA), we can trace the name’s trajectory:
Year | Rank | # Births | % Births |
---|---|---|---|
1910 | 127 | 215 | 0.0611% |
1920 | 145 | 1,010 | 0.0908% |
1930 | 51 | 3,879 | 0.3713% |
1940 | 14 | 15,197 | 1.4298% |
1941 | 14 | 16,799 | 1.4926% |
1942 | 16 | 17,480 | 1.3843% |
1943 | 17 | 17,731 | 1.3582% |
1944 | 19 | 16,271 | 1.3128% |
1945 | 20 | 14,695 | 1.2049% |
1946 | 20 | 17,558 | 1.1899% |
1947 | 20 | 18,792 | 1.1258% |
1950 | 24 | 15,267 | 0.9482% |
1960 | 37 | 11,836 | 0.6247% |
1970 | 45 | 7,425 | 0.4666% |
1980 | 94 | 3,178 | 0.2174% |
1990 | 146 | 2,162 | 0.1304% |
2000 | 264 | 1,218 | 0.0797% |
2010 | 380 | 722 | 0.0501% |
2020 | 595 | 411 | 0.0323% |
2023 | 839 | 240 | 0.0185% |
As the table indicates, Jerry peaked in popularity during the 1940s, holding a top 20 rank for much of the decade. The name has steadily declined in usage since then, though it still maintains a presence. This decline could be attributed to evolving naming trends and a preference for more modern or unique names.

Names Like Jerry
If you like Jerry, you’ll love these other names like Jerry.
Choosing a name similar to Jerry can involve exploring variations, similar sounds, or names with related meanings. Here’s a breakdown:
Variants of Jerry: These are names directly derived from or closely related to Jerry.
- Gerrey: A less common but still recognizable variant.
- Gerry: A popular alternative, also a diminutive of Gerald or Gerard.
- Jerre, Jerrey, Jerrie: These are variations in spelling that may appeal to those seeking a slightly different take.
Names that Sound Like Jerry: These names share phonetic similarities.
- Jerri: A slightly different spelling, often used for both boys and girls.
- Jorry: A Scandinavian name with a similar sound.
Names Similar to Jerry (Related in Meaning or Style):
- Gerald: The classic, full-form name from which Jerry often originates. This offers a more formal option.
- Jaron: An Israeli name meaning "cry of rejoicing."
- Jeremiah: A Hebrew name meaning "God will exalt."
- Jeremy: Another popular diminutive of Jeremiah, shares a similar feel to Jerry.
- Jerome: A Greek name meaning "sacred name," providing a different yet classic alternative.
